YT15 MXC is a 2015 Vauxhall Cascada in White with a 1,956c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.8%.
Across all 2015 Vauxhall Cascada models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.8% with a typical mileage of 40,084 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Cascada f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 122 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YT15 MXC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Cascada typ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 11 years old, this Vauxhall Cascada is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
